This course is designed to assist the student's transition into professional practice. The course examines independent contractor/self employment and paid employee opportunities. Professional standards of practice are reviewed with a focus on legal issues and trends. Aspects of establishing and maintaining an individual practice will be examined including small business planning, business finances, bookkeeping, and marketing/promotions. Prerequisites: MAST 201, MAST 202, MAST 203 Each with a grade of C or better Co-requisites: MAST 204, BEMT 103, Mathematics elective; Humanities elective 3 credits (3 lecture hours), spring semester
